On November 29, 2024, the "Aviation Event 2024 SOF" took place at Sofia Airport in Bulgaria. This international aviation conference provided a stage for representatives from business, science and politics to discuss the latest developments, challenges and future strategies of the industry. Among the prominent speakers were executives from airports and airlines, including Sofia Airport and Lufthansa Technik Sofia.
A central theme of the conference was the role of airports and airlines in emerging markets in Eastern Europe. Panels such as "Navigating the Skies: Aviation's Vital Role in Global Economic Development" highlighted the economic opportunities for aviation in the region. Another discussion was devoted to the use of artificial intelligence in aviation, moderated by international industry experts.
A highlight was the presentation by Preslav Milchev, CEO of Lufthansa Technik Sofia, who addressed the growing importance of Maintenance, Repair, and Overhaul (MRO) in Eastern Europe. At the same time, experts such as Sergio Colella from SITA Europe analyzed the challenges and opportunities of modern technology for airlines and airports.
The focus on Central European markets and the economic and technological transformations in aviation was particularly interesting. Workshops and keynotes offered in-depth insights into strategic partnerships, infrastructure planning and the integration of innovative technologies.
The event attracted a large number of decision-makers and experts and highlighted the relevance of strategic cooperation. However, critical voices pointed to the need to generate concrete results and implementable plans from such events in order to ensure sustainable industry development.
